A 23-year-old member asked:
What foods contain tryptophan?

A lot: Many foods contain tryptophan, an essential Amino Acid that you can only get through diet. Chicken and turkey both have tryptophan. It is required for the production of melatonin, a critical compound for our circadian sleep rhythms. Many people believe that tryptophan induces sleep, while usually it is the large fatty meals that make us feel tired and not the ingestion of tryptophan alone.

Precursor of 5HTP: Egg,cheese,tofu,pineapple & almonds are rich in tryptophan.
